Output 73dd4c33263dcfda23ec05dfbea545c796159af27a0853ec00a42784219711ef:11

value
3003610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b496fdc94c8ad4c6e38d976c046dacd35509ed1 OP_EQUAL
address
34BJ9DHN4vW3Nzk3DvBXeJj8nR6E91c7jm
transaction
73dd4c33263dcfda23ec05dfbea545c796159af27a0853ec00a42784219711ef
confirmations
334208
spent
true